summaryrefslogtreecommitdiff
path: root/sys/src/libdraw/creadimage.c
diff options
context:
space:
mode:
authorcinap_lenrek <cinap_lenrek@centraldogma>2011-09-05 18:34:46 +0200
committercinap_lenrek <cinap_lenrek@centraldogma>2011-09-05 18:34:46 +0200
commit45f2fd3c01768f6483e4d583e4ca06c8e11362f4 (patch)
tree38cc5e0dc9dd398f4dbe16d7e5b12288f6cc7346 /sys/src/libdraw/creadimage.c
parent9cddb6ed33051b8d19753e348a2eed3296622397 (diff)
libdraw: fix old subfont leak
Diffstat (limited to 'sys/src/libdraw/creadimage.c')
-rw-r--r--sys/src/libdraw/creadimage.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/sys/src/libdraw/creadimage.c b/sys/src/libdraw/creadimage.c
index b9d7e4ed8..351177e8d 100644
--- a/sys/src/libdraw/creadimage.c
+++ b/sys/src/libdraw/creadimage.c
@@ -58,7 +58,6 @@ creadimage(Display *d, int fd, int dolock)
if(dolock)
lockdisplay(d);
i = allocimage(d, r, chan, 0, 0);
- setmalloctag(i, getcallerpc(&d));
if(dolock)
unlockdisplay(d);
if(i == nil)
@@ -68,6 +67,7 @@ creadimage(Display *d, int fd, int dolock)
if(i == nil)
return nil;
}
+ setmalloctag(i, getcallerpc(&d));
ncblock = _compblocksize(r, chantodepth(chan));
buf = malloc(ncblock);
if(buf == nil)